Chimeric DNA is

A

Gene clone

B

Recombinant-DNA

C

Transposon

D

Vector shuttle

Correct Answer

Option B

Detailed Explanation

Chimeric DNA refers to a form of recombinant DNA, which is created by combining genetic material from different sources, often involving the insertion of a gene from one organism into the DNA of another. This process allows for the study and manipulation of genes, facilitating advances in biotechnology and medicine. In contrast, a gene clone (A) refers specifically to identical copies of a particular gene, a transposon (C) is a mobile genetic element that can change its position within the genome, and a vector shuttle (D) is a vehicle used to transfer genetic material into a host cell but does not itself represent a combination of DNA from different sources.
